- How long have you use it?

In recent days, and I wonder how I did not ...

- What is the particular feature you like best and least?

Plus:

- PADs are pleasant to the touch and very large
- The function ROLL (simulates a rolling snare for example)
- X & Y larger than a laptop
- Design
- Ergonomics for the parameters (such as the KONTROL49)

Minimum:

- Provides software bof but good software offerings .... except that apps Light Edition ...
- X & Y assign the MIDI LEARN is almost impossible without understanding the need to use the HOLD button (not the doc) because when you loose your finger from the controller all the time ca sending the CC of the X axis, then to the midi learn on the Y I will not tell ...
- No power supply (even if the operating mode USB power)

- Have you tried many other models before acqurir?

I was looking for a Controller X & Y because it's KONTROL49 (joystick) is really bad
I have not found other controllers with pads and a set X & Y

- How do you report qualitprix?

Rather good, although the price might be a little lower

- With the exprience, you do again this choice? ...

without hesitation, I like the ergonomics of controllers KORG
I have the AIM PAD X & Y on the KONTROL49 but ...
As against the pads of KONTROL49 are smaller are less pleasant than the PADKONTROL
